GCF of 77 and 56 is the divisor that we get when the remainder becomes 0 after doing long division repeatedly. Step 1: Divide 77 (larger number) by 56 (smaller number). Step 2: Since the remainder ≠ 0, we will divide the divisor of step 1 (56) by the remainder (21). Step 3: Repeat this process until the ...

HCF of 30 and 42 is the divisor that we get when the remainder becomes 0 after doing long division repeatedly. Step 1: Divide 42 (larger number) by 30 (smaller number). Step 2: Since the remainder ≠ 0, we will divide the divisor of step 1 (30) by the remainder (12). Step 3: Repeat this process until the ...
WebFind the prime factorization of 28. 28 = 2 × 2 × 7. Find the prime factorization of 77. 77 = 7 × 11. To find the GCF, multiply all the prime factors common to both numbers: Therefore, GCF = 7. Factors of 2 are 1, 2, and factors of 3 are 1, 3. The only common factor is 1 and hence they are co-prime. Explanation: The factors of 42 are 1,2,3,6,7,14,21,42; The factors of 231 are 1,3,7,11,21,33,77,231.
